How much power loss

Due to a miraculous occurance that has left me in possesion of a mountain motor for my IROC I am getting ready to pull out my mild 355 and get a little nuts. Going in is a Bowtie block with 400CI, AFR 210 heads and 500 N/A hp + the bottle. How much power loss do you guys think I would have to endure if I used the Hooker 2055s and hooked them up to my brand new Hooker cat back instead of buying 2210s and putting on a 4" mufflex? Will the 2055s bolt to the AFRs? I am sure it will cost some HP but not sure its going to matter to me since there will be more than enough to start with. Any input appreciated.
